Digunumal Population - Baudh, Orissa

Digunumal is a medium size village located in Kantamal Block of Baudh district, Orissa with total 225 families residing. The Digunumal village has population of 909 of which 445 are males while 464 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Digunumal village population of children with age 0-6 is 162 which makes up 17.82 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Digunumal village is 1043 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Digunumal as per census is 1000, higher than Orissa average of 941.

Digunumal village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Digunumal village was 55.02 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Digunumal Male literacy stands at 69.51 % while female literacy rate was 41.25 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 20.24 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 13.64 % of total population in Digunumal village.

Work Profile

In Digunumal village out of total population, 539 were engaged in work activities. 42.12 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 57.88 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 539 workers engaged in Main Work, 165 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 47 were Agricultural labourer.
